rvneto 0 Denunciar post Postado Junho 19, 2015 Tenho uma trigger before update de um campo de uma determinada tabela. Essa trigger dispara uma procedure que grava uma tabela de log, porém o campo faz parte da PK da tabela (Chave composta). Portanto, ao atualizar o campo, pode dar um erro de PK existente, então não atualiza o registro na tabela, mas dispara a trigger e grava o log. Tem como testar se o update foi realizado com sucesso (Sem ter que fazer um select na propria tabela para ver se o campo atualizou)? Compartilhar este post Link para o post Compartilhar em outros sites
Motta 645 Denunciar post Postado Junho 19, 2015 Tentou com uma trigger de AFTER ? Eu não faria uma tabela de log com FKs , deixaria ela sem FKs Compartilhar este post Link para o post Compartilhar em outros sites